Output d58215560fd91f84fa26550f7640ea3c1a727b175fb11e56a8bbe4c472ffc90b:1

value
106020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fe1872b28fff1c601efb6be7059c234183a52db OP_EQUALVERIFY OP_CHECKSIG
address
18HNZ7fakQaASdxX1VtDEDreNUEweFTqVD
transaction
d58215560fd91f84fa26550f7640ea3c1a727b175fb11e56a8bbe4c472ffc90b
spent
true